Accessible Ramp Construction in Wilmington, NC

Accessible ramp construction services provide property owners with custom-designed solutions to improve entryways for individuals with mobility challenges. These projects typically include building ramps for residential homes, multi-family dwellings, or commercial properties to ensure safe and convenient access. The services cover a range of ramp types, such as permanent, portable, or modular designs, tailored to meet specific accessibility needs and property layouts. Homeowners often seek information about the materials used, compliance with local building codes, and how the ramps integrate with existing structures to ensure both safety and aesthetic appeal.

Before requesting accessible ramp constru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of customization available, including options for different heights, widths, and surface textures. They may also inquire about the durability of materials, installation requirements, and whether permits are necessary for their project. Clarifying these aspects helps ensure the completed ramp provides reliable accessibility, fits seamlessly into the property, and complies with relevant regulations.

FAQ

Accessible Ramp Construction Questions

What types of accessible ramps are available for construction? Various options include modular, custom-built, and portable ramps designed to meet different property needs.

What properties typically require accessible ramp construction? Homes, commercial buildings, and public spaces that need to improve wheelchair accessibility often request ramp installation.

What should property owners consider when planning a ramp project? Factors include the location, slope requirements, space availability, and the intended use of the ramp.

Are there different materials used for accessible ramps? Yes, common materials include aluminum, wood, and steel, chosen based on durability and property aesthetics.
